Infrared and ultraviolet spectra of 3-fluorobenzoylchloride

The absorption spectra of 3-fluorobenzoylchloride have been studied in IR and UV regions in liquid and vapour phases respectively. The 0,0 band has been identified at 33 928 cm-1 (2 946,6 Å) and vibrational analysis has been proposed in terms of the fundamental frequencies, 143 cm-1 in the ground state and 429, 529, 605, 806 and 929 cm-1 in the excited state. The IR and UV spectra are correlated. The IR spectrum of 2-fluorobenzoylchloride was also recorded for comparison.
